<?xml version="1.0" encoding="iso-8859-1"?>
<rss version="2.0">
<channel>
  <title>PEAR Forum</title>
  <link>http://www.pear-forum.org/index.php</link>
  <description>PHP Extension and Application Repository</description>
  <language>english</language>
  <copyright>(c) Copyright 2006-2010 by PEAR Forum</copyright>
  <managingEditor>PEAR-forum.org &lt;pear@mowd.nl&gt;</managingEditor>
  <webMaster>PEAR-forum.org &lt;pear@mowd.nl&gt;</webMaster>
  <pubDate>Tue Sep 07, 2010 7:35 pm</pubDate>
  <lastBuildDate>Tue Sep 07, 2010 7:35 pm</lastBuildDate>
  <docs>http://backend.userland.com/rss</docs>
  <generator>phpBB2 RSS Syndication Mod by Lucas</generator>
  <ttl>1</ttl>

  <image>
    <title>PEAR Forum</title>
    <url>http://www.pear-forum.org/images/pear-icon.png</url>
    <link>http://www.pear-forum.org/</link>
    <description>PHP Extension and Application Repository</description>
  </image>

                                      <item>
                                        <title>Re: DataGrid Problems</title>
                                        <link>http://www.pear-forum.org/viewtopic.php?p=3936#3936</link>
                                        <description>&lt;br /&gt;
                                      Author: &lt;a href='http://www.pear-forum.org/profile.php?mode=viewprofile&amp;amp;u=918'&gt;mark&lt;/a&gt;&lt;br /&gt;&lt;br /&gt;
                                      Posted: Wed May 21, 2008 10:48 pm&lt;br /&gt;&lt;br /&gt;
                                      &lt;br /&gt;&lt;br /&gt;
                                      PinkCloud, please open a bug report on pear.php.net about this issue.</description>
                                        <comments>http://www.pear-forum.org/viewtopic.php?p=3936#3936</comments>
                                        <author>mark</author>
                                        <pubDate>Wed May 21, 2008 10:48 pm</pubDate>
                                        <guid isPermaLink="true">http://www.pear-forum.org/viewtopic.php?p=3936#3936</guid>
                                      </item>
                                      <item>
                                        <title>Re: DataGrid Problems</title>
                                        <link>http://www.pear-forum.org/viewtopic.php?p=3935#3935</link>
                                        <description>&lt;br /&gt;
                                      Author: &lt;a href='http://www.pear-forum.org/profile.php?mode=viewprofile&amp;amp;u=108'&gt;vanila2000&lt;/a&gt;&lt;br /&gt;&lt;br /&gt;
                                      Posted: Wed May 21, 2008 7:29 am&lt;br /&gt;&lt;br /&gt;
                                      &lt;br /&gt;&lt;br /&gt;
                                      No. unfortunately, this post has not received any reply at all and I had to switch to simple php programming for the report ...&lt;img src=&quot;images/smiles/icon_sad.gif&quot; alt=&quot;Sad&quot; border=&quot;0&quot; /&gt;</description>
                                        <comments>http://www.pear-forum.org/viewtopic.php?p=3935#3935</comments>
                                        <author>vanila2000</author>
                                        <pubDate>Wed May 21, 2008 7:29 am</pubDate>
                                        <guid isPermaLink="true">http://www.pear-forum.org/viewtopic.php?p=3935#3935</guid>
                                      </item>
                                      <item>
                                        <title>Re: DataGrid Problems</title>
                                        <link>http://www.pear-forum.org/viewtopic.php?p=3931#3931</link>
                                        <description>&lt;br /&gt;
                                      Author: &lt;a href='http://www.pear-forum.org/profile.php?mode=viewprofile&amp;amp;u=3434'&gt;PinkCloud&lt;/a&gt;&lt;br /&gt;&lt;br /&gt;
                                      Posted: Tue May 20, 2008 10:42 am&lt;br /&gt;&lt;br /&gt;
                                      &lt;br /&gt;&lt;br /&gt;
                                      Hi there,&lt;br /&gt;
&lt;br /&gt;
I have been trying to attempt to exactly the same thing as you, but when i try to change the label the data does not print.&lt;br /&gt;
&lt;br /&gt;
I know this post is quite old now, but has anyone got any answers on how to do this?</description>
                                        <comments>http://www.pear-forum.org/viewtopic.php?p=3931#3931</comments>
                                        <author>PinkCloud</author>
                                        <pubDate>Tue May 20, 2008 10:42 am</pubDate>
                                        <guid isPermaLink="true">http://www.pear-forum.org/viewtopic.php?p=3931#3931</guid>
                                      </item>
                                      <item>
                                        <title>Re: DataGrid Problems</title>
                                        <link>http://www.pear-forum.org/viewtopic.php?p=121#121</link>
                                        <description>&lt;br /&gt;
                                      Author: &lt;a href='http://www.pear-forum.org/profile.php?mode=viewprofile&amp;amp;u=108'&gt;vanila2000&lt;/a&gt;&lt;br /&gt;&lt;br /&gt;
                                      Posted: Wed Jun 28, 2006 11:18 am&lt;br /&gt;&lt;br /&gt;
                                      &lt;br /&gt;&lt;br /&gt;
                                      Can anyone please help me out??? it is really urgent .. Thanks in adv.</description>
                                        <comments>http://www.pear-forum.org/viewtopic.php?p=121#121</comments>
                                        <author>vanila2000</author>
                                        <pubDate>Wed Jun 28, 2006 11:18 am</pubDate>
                                        <guid isPermaLink="true">http://www.pear-forum.org/viewtopic.php?p=121#121</guid>
                                      </item>
                                      <item>
                                        <title>DataGrid Problems</title>
                                        <link>http://www.pear-forum.org/viewtopic.php?p=116#116</link>
                                        <description>&lt;br /&gt;
                                      Author: &lt;a href='http://www.pear-forum.org/profile.php?mode=viewprofile&amp;amp;u=108'&gt;vanila2000&lt;/a&gt;&lt;br /&gt;&lt;br /&gt;
                                      Posted: Fri Jun 23, 2006 1:39 pm&lt;br /&gt;&lt;br /&gt;
                                      &lt;br /&gt;&lt;br /&gt;
                                      Hi, &lt;br /&gt;
I downloaded the example script given for datagrid. my script is like this:&lt;br /&gt;
&amp;lt;html&amp;gt;&lt;br /&gt;
&amp;lt;style type=&amp;quot;text/css&amp;quot;&amp;gt;&lt;br /&gt;
&amp;lt;!--&lt;br /&gt;
body {&lt;br /&gt;
    font-family: Verdana, Geneva, Arial, Helvetica, sans-serif; &lt;br /&gt;
    font-size: 11px;&lt;br /&gt;
}&lt;br /&gt;
&lt;br /&gt;
table.fruits {&lt;br /&gt;
    border-left: solid 1px #990033;&lt;br /&gt;
    border-top: solid 1px #990033;&lt;br /&gt;
    border-bottom: solid 1px #990033;&lt;br /&gt;
    font-family: Verdana, Geneva, Arial, Helvetica, sans-serif; &lt;br /&gt;
    font-size: 11px;&lt;br /&gt;
    border-collapse: collapse;     &lt;br /&gt;
    width: 36em;&lt;br /&gt;
    margin-left: 1em;&lt;br /&gt;
}&lt;br /&gt;
&lt;br /&gt;
table.fruits th {&lt;br /&gt;
    text-align: center;&lt;br /&gt;
    border-right: solid 1px #990033;&lt;br /&gt;
    border-bottom: solid 1px #990033;&lt;br /&gt;
    background: #990033;&lt;br /&gt;
    padding: 2px;&lt;br /&gt;
    color: white;&lt;br /&gt;
    padding-left: 1em;&lt;br /&gt;
    padding-right: 1em;&lt;br /&gt;
}&lt;br /&gt;
&lt;br /&gt;
table.fruits th a {&lt;br /&gt;
    color: white;&lt;br /&gt;
    text-decoration: none;&lt;br /&gt;
}&lt;br /&gt;
&lt;br /&gt;
table.fruits th a:hover {&lt;br /&gt;
    color: #EEEEEE;&lt;br /&gt;
}&lt;br /&gt;
    &lt;br /&gt;
table.fruits td {&lt;br /&gt;
    text-align: right;&lt;br /&gt;
    border-right: solid 1px #990033;&lt;br /&gt;
    padding: 2px;&lt;br /&gt;
}&lt;br /&gt;
&lt;br /&gt;
table.fruits tr.odd {&lt;br /&gt;
    background: #F4F4F4;&lt;br /&gt;
}&lt;br /&gt;
&lt;br /&gt;
p.paging {&lt;br /&gt;
    text-align: center;&lt;br /&gt;
    font-weight: bold;&lt;br /&gt;
}&lt;br /&gt;
&lt;br /&gt;
p.paging a {&lt;br /&gt;
    color: #990033;&lt;br /&gt;
}&lt;br /&gt;
&lt;br /&gt;
--&amp;gt;&lt;br /&gt;
&amp;lt;/style&amp;gt;&lt;br /&gt;
&amp;lt;?php&lt;br /&gt;
/* Includes */    &lt;br /&gt;
require_once &amp;quot;PEAR.php&amp;quot;;&lt;br /&gt;
define(&amp;quot;DB_DATAOBJECT_NO_OVERLOAD&amp;quot;,true); /* This is needed for some buggy versions of PHP4 */&lt;br /&gt;
require_once &amp;quot;DB/DataObject.php&amp;quot;;&lt;br /&gt;
require_once &amp;quot;Structures/DataGrid.php&amp;quot;;    &lt;br /&gt;
&lt;br /&gt;
/* Database and DataObject setup */&lt;br /&gt;
$options = &amp;amp;PEAR::getStaticProperty(&amp;quot;DB_DataObject&amp;quot;,&amp;quot;options&amp;quot;);&lt;br /&gt;
$options[&amp;quot;database&amp;quot;] =  &amp;quot;oci8://user:passwd@host/dbname&amp;quot;; (i am giving my own user here)&lt;br /&gt;
$options[&amp;quot;proxy&amp;quot;] = &amp;quot;full&amp;quot;;&lt;br /&gt;
DB_DataObject::debugLevel(0);&lt;br /&gt;
&lt;br /&gt;
class DataObject_Fruits extends DB_DataObject &lt;br /&gt;
{&lt;br /&gt;
    var $__table = &amp;quot;fruits&amp;quot;;&lt;br /&gt;
    var $id;&lt;br /&gt;
    var $name;&lt;br /&gt;
    var $stock;&lt;br /&gt;
    var $price;&lt;br /&gt;
}&lt;br /&gt;
&lt;br /&gt;
/* Instantiate */&lt;br /&gt;
$dataobject = new DataObject_Fruits();&lt;br /&gt;
$dataobject-&amp;gt;keys(&amp;quot;id&amp;quot;);&lt;br /&gt;
$datagrid =&amp;amp; new Structures_DataGrid(10); /* 10 rows per table */&lt;br /&gt;
&lt;br /&gt;
/* Required in order to use the &amp;quot;fields&amp;quot; and &amp;quot;labels&amp;quot; options */&lt;br /&gt;
//global $datagridOptions;&lt;br /&gt;
$options[&amp;quot;generate_columns&amp;quot;] = true; &lt;br /&gt;
&lt;br /&gt;
/* The fields we want to display */&lt;br /&gt;
$options[&amp;quot;fields&amp;quot;] = array (&amp;quot;id&amp;quot;,&amp;quot;name&amp;quot;, &amp;quot;stock&amp;quot;, &amp;quot;price&amp;quot;);&lt;br /&gt;
&lt;br /&gt;
/* Translate the fields names into user-friendly labels */&lt;br /&gt;
$options[&amp;quot;labels&amp;quot;] = array (&lt;br /&gt;
     &amp;quot;id&amp;quot;=&amp;gt;&amp;quot;Product Id&amp;quot;,&lt;br /&gt;
     &amp;quot;name&amp;quot; =&amp;gt; &amp;quot;Product Name&amp;quot;, &lt;br /&gt;
    &amp;quot;stock&amp;quot; =&amp;gt; &amp;quot;Quantity in Stock&amp;quot;, &lt;br /&gt;
    &amp;quot;price&amp;quot; =&amp;gt; &amp;quot;Price (&amp;amp;euro;)&amp;quot;&lt;br /&gt;
);&lt;br /&gt;
//print_r($datagridOptions);&lt;br /&gt;
echo &amp;quot;&amp;lt;p align=\&amp;quot;center\&amp;quot; &amp;gt; size=\&amp;quot;4\&amp;quot;&amp;gt; FRUIT WISE REPORT &amp;lt;br&amp;gt;&amp;quot;;&lt;br /&gt;
/* Pass these options at binding time */&lt;br /&gt;
$datagrid-&amp;gt;bind($dataobject,$print_r);&lt;br /&gt;
/* Get a reference to the Renderer object */    &lt;br /&gt;
$renderer =&amp;amp; $datagrid-&amp;gt;getRenderer();&lt;br /&gt;
&lt;br /&gt;
/* For the &amp;lt;table&amp;gt; element : */&lt;br /&gt;
$renderer-&amp;gt;setTableAttribute(&amp;quot;class&amp;quot;, &amp;quot;fruits&amp;quot;);&lt;br /&gt;
&lt;br /&gt;
/* For every odd &amp;lt;tr&amp;gt; elements */&lt;br /&gt;
$renderer-&amp;gt;setTableOddRowAttributes(array (&amp;quot;class&amp;quot; =&amp;gt; &amp;quot;odd&amp;quot;));&lt;br /&gt;
&lt;br /&gt;
$pagingHtml = $renderer-&amp;gt;getPaging();&lt;br /&gt;
echo &amp;quot;&amp;lt;p class=\&amp;quot;paging\&amp;quot;&amp;gt;Pages : $pagingHtml&amp;lt;/p&amp;gt;&amp;quot;;&lt;br /&gt;
&lt;br /&gt;
/* And render */&lt;br /&gt;
$datagrid-&amp;gt;render();&lt;br /&gt;
?&amp;gt;&lt;br /&gt;
&lt;br /&gt;
Here, whenever i try to change the labels in the output, the data is not printed. That is in the bind statement like this:&lt;br /&gt;
&lt;br /&gt;
$datagrid-&amp;gt;bind($dataobject,$datagridOptions);&lt;br /&gt;
&lt;br /&gt;
However, if i give&lt;br /&gt;
&lt;br /&gt;
$datagrid-&amp;gt;bind($dataobject,$print_r);&lt;br /&gt;
I am getting the data with the table field names as the labels.&lt;br /&gt;
&lt;br /&gt;
I want to change the lables. How do i do it? Even though in the code i have defined the labels, it is not printed. Please tell me how to do it.</description>
                                        <comments>http://www.pear-forum.org/viewtopic.php?p=116#116</comments>
                                        <author>vanila2000</author>
                                        <pubDate>Fri Jun 23, 2006 1:39 pm</pubDate>
                                        <guid isPermaLink="true">http://www.pear-forum.org/viewtopic.php?p=116#116</guid>
                                      </item></channel></rss>